What you need to know about Lumut
Accessible by coastal federal roads and a short drive from Seri Manjung and Sitiawan, getting around is easiest by car, while ferries from the Lumut jetty provide regular crossings to Pangkor Island; trips to Ipoh take around 1–1.5 hours by road. The town mixes single-storey and two-storey terrace houses, some semi-detached properties, and low-rise apartments, with a local rental market that caters to families and workers in marine, naval and tourism sectors. Everyday shopping, health and schooling needs are met locally or in nearby Seri Manjung, and commute patterns are largely regional rather than metropolitan. Buyers can expect a market influenced by steady local demand for affordable, landed homes and occasional tourist-driven rental interest, rather than rapid speculative growth.
